EME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2013 in Review
211 of the 3,459 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Emcor (EME) for Q4 2013, worth a combined $2.76B — up 7.4% from $2.57B a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 36 funds closed out of EME and 19 opened new positions — a net loss of 17 holders — while 89 trimmed existing stakes and 84 added.
The largest buyer was Goldman Sachs, adding an estimated $51.5M. The largest seller was Systematic Financial Management, cutting an estimated $97.3M.
